Boom's Series A Funding Success
Austin-based Boom has successfully raised $15 million in a Series A funding round, with S3 Ventures leading the investment. Joining this round were Mischief VC, Starting Line VC, Company Ventures, and Gilgamesh Ventures. Boom specializes in developing a suite of products designed for property managers to facilitate on-time payments, minimize fraud, and increase revenue throughout the renter lifecycle.
Company Background
Boom offers a variety of tools for property managers, including rent reporting and a resident app, among other features. These products aim to streamline processes and improve financial outcomes for both property managers and renters.
Leadership Team
The company was co-founded by Kirill Moizik, who serves as the Chief Technology Officer, and Rob Whiting. Both founders have been instrumental in steering Boom towards its growth and development goals.
